Holocaust Survivor Dr. Erica Miller Speaks At The Pasadena Recovery Center
Dr. Erica Miller spoke at the Pasadena Recovery Center yesterday about her new book, “The Dr. Erica Miller Story: From Trauma to Triumph“. Between the ages of 7 and 11, Miller and her family lived in a Nazi holding camp in the Ukraine. She eventually resettled in Israel and earned a PhD in clinical psychology and a Masters in Marriage and Family. She then moved to California where she developed an number of mental health clinics which she continues to run today.

Understand, Prevent and Resolve Life’s Challenges
Hey folks, here is a great resource on health topics. Helpguide.org is a website with the mission to help people understand, prevent, and resolve many of life’s challenges.
This organization empowers people with knowledge and hope. Their goal is to give you the information and encouragement you need to take charge of your health and well-being and make healthy choices.
Helpguide was launched in 1999, following the suicide of Robert and Jeanne Segal’s daughter, Morgan. Her family believes that Morgan’s tragedy could have been avoided if she had had easy access to supportive health information. The mission of helpguide.org is to honor her memory and compassionate spirit by providing balanced, up-to-date, and motivating information about mental health, relationships, and lifelong wellness.
